Charles Frederick Stein was a legendary piano scale designer who eventually had his own company. Very few CFS pianos were made(I’ve heard less than 2500 total)from the late-1920s through WW2. These were special

These were very expensive plaything of the rich in the ‘20s that actually played the dynamics of the musician, not just a notes like a traditional foot pumper player piano. Although it’s not a big 6’ or larger grand…. It’s a very nice and balanced sound for a small instrument
